Laurent Paté is a French painter whose work stands out for a vibrant and expressive approach to color and material. Originally from Normandy, he found in knife oil painting a technique that matches his creative energy and his wish to give relief to his compositions.
His works oscillate between maritime landscapes inspired by Brittany and Normandy, and more contemporary creations where abstraction meets a certain emotional spontaneity. Each canvas seems to reflect a mood, an instant captured with intensity.
